The Cable Wide-Grip Rear Pulldown Behind Neck targets the upper back muscles, promoting strength and stability in the shoulder girdle. It's an advanced exercise that helps with improving posture and building muscle definition in the back.
How to do it
- Sit at the cable machine, securing your thighs under the pads.
- Grasp the bar with a wide overhand grip.
- Pull the bar down behind your neck while keeping your torso upright.
- Squeeze your shoulder blades together at the bottom of the movement.
- Slowly return the bar to the starting position with control.
